Perfectly tasty, fresh or toasted under the grill... ready to spread!

The razor shell has a sweet taste, marked by a characteristic scent. It is usually cooked with a hint of garlic. To enhance this preparation La Paimpolaise has cooked the razor shell with Cider Brandy, that brings a fruity note to the original flavor with more amplitude in the mouth.

INTERESTING FACTS

Fishing the razor clam must be the easiest fishing there is... like a child's play, especially during spring large tides.

Its shell is made of two long parts, that look like a knife's handle. These molluscs feed by filtering water

INGREDIENTS

Cream (milk), pout (fish), razor clams 22% (mollusc), cider brandy 1,1%, Millac sea salt, butter (milk), garlic, parsley, olive oil, seaweeds (wakame), pepper, thickener: agar-agar (algae extract).

The information in bold is intended for people who are intolerant or allergic.

NUTRITIONAL VALUE FOR 100G (3,52 OZ.)

Energy 870 kJ / 210 Kcal; fat 18g among which saturated fats 10g; glucids 3,2g among which sugar 0,2g; proteins 8,8g; salt 1,1g.
